BROKEN ARROW, Okla. – SWOSU Men's Golf had three individuals earn All-Great American Conference honors, announced Sunday night at the GAC Awards Banquet.
Ben Jackson was named Freshman of the Year and earned Second Team All-GAC honors alongside
Conrado Diaz Ermacora, while
Ryan Carlisle was named an All-GAC Honorable Mention selection.
Academically, Carlisle, along with
Otto Heden,
Caspar Graf, and
Sutton McMillan, was named to the GAC Academic Honor Roll, awarded to student-athletes who maintain a minimum 3.5 GPA and have completed at least one year of full-time college residency.
Jackson becomes SWOSU's second GAC Freshman of the Year, joining Stefan Idstam (2014). He recorded four top-20 finishes this season, highlighted by a runner-up finish at the Hillcat Classic, where he helped lead the Bulldogs to their first outright team title in a decade. Jackson holds a 73.9 scoring average and is ranked No. 37 in the NCAA Central Region.
Diaz Ermacora, a sophomore, joins Jackson on the Second Team after posting four top-20 finishes of his own. His top performance came at the Skip Wagnon Invitational, where he placed third at nine-under par. He currently ranks No. 29 in the region with a 73.2 scoring average.
Carlisle earns the first All-GAC honor of his career after recording 12th- and third-place finishes this season. He is ranked inside the top 50 in the region with a 74.1 scoring average. His third-place finish came at the Hillcat Classic, where he played a key role in SWOSU's team victory.
